Property consultants will advise on locations and types of building that suit the plans and budget of a would-be developer, guiding them towards purchases that represent a real chance of success. 

Every building is subject to a unique set of rules:

Some come with unbreakable long-term leases, others are defined as short let and still more can only be bought outright. Consultants will advise each client on which type of building is right for them, using their circumstances, ambitions, and budget as guidelines.

With each purchase designed to reap different rewards, property developers need expert advice on how to gain those rewards: property consultants can match the right building to the right requirements.
